In honor of the 10th Anniversary, the Auction also included a "lightning round" of 10 Restaurant Experiences and 10 Door Prize Giveaways as the Center’s way of thanking all of our guests for coming out to share this special evening!
 

The annual Gala dinner is held every spring and features the unique talents of acclaimed area chefs. The program also includes a live auction full of exceptional items and one-of-a-kind packages. Each year, the Gala raises over $200,000 to support the programs and services of the Center.
